Running so many components may yeild your power supply insufficient. It's almost a gaurantee that a 250 watt PS will not handle that many components. Power supplys are a universal fit, so it's an easy install, just $$ if you buy from a retailer. a 350w ps at bestbuy is $65, but a 400w from an online distributor can cost as little as $6.
